The SAU Women’s basketball team pulled off an impressive win over number 20 Olivet Nazarene on Tuesday night.

The Bees got off to a hot start in Lee-Lohman Arena, getting ahead early in the first half and staying ahead for almost the entire game. St. Ambrose limited the Tigers shooting to under 32%, and efficient clearing helped the Bees hold on to their lead to start the second half.

An impressive defensive effort ushered the Bees to a 47-28 lead at halftime after an impressive 23-9 offensive performance in the second quarter. The Bees extended their lead to 22 before ONU hit their stride and began to close the gap.

ONU’s sudden rhythm carried them back into the game, and the Tigers saw a 30 point run to
take a one-point lead, their only time ahead of the Bees for the entire game.

Maintaining composure, strong offensive plays by Shayne Smith and Madeline Prestegaard, and two free throws from Maddy Cash pushed the bees ahead of the Tigers 77-72 with just over
a minute left in the third quarter.

The Bees proved to be too much, as the Tigers’ rally wasn’t enough to rattle the SAU.

Jaynee Prestegaard led the pack with 27 points and 14 rebounds, shooting 10 for 16 from the
field. Her sister Madeline Prestegaard shot “8 for 8” from the free-throw line and recorded another 6
points on the night. Smith tallied 16 points, and Cash and Kylie Wroblewski had 10 points each.
SAU will next travel to Mount Mercy on Saturday for their first away game of the season.
